The Quality Inn Morgantown is situated within walking distance of the West Virginia University and WVU Coliseum, approximately eight miles from Morgantown Airport, and 65 miles from Pittsburgh International Airport. Local attractions include Cheat Lake, Coopers Rock State Park, Krepps Park, Seneca Shopping Center, and Forks of Cheat Winery.Hotel amenities include free continental breakfast, free weekday newspaper, free coffee in the lobby, free local telephone calls, fax/photocopying services, and business center. Guests may also enjoy the seasonal outdoor pool.Guest rooms feature satellite/cable TVs, telephones, dataports, coffeemakers, hairdryers, irons, ironing boards, and voicemail.

By A Yahoo! Contributor, 06/25/08
Run-down; tub wouldn't drain, electrical fixtures dangled from the walls by their cords, ceiling tiles sagged from water damage. Complaining about the tub brought an ineffective shot of Drano and nothing more. It seems that maintenence is understaffed or underskilled or both. Housekeeping replaced linens and made beds, but did not clean. On the plus side, the desk staff was friendly and the desk/breakfast areas were nice. It's all stuff that wouldn't have shocked me in a $50 hotel, but at $90, I felt cheated.
 
 
 
 
 
Terrible place
By A Yahoo! Contributor, 03/02/08
We stayed here last summer, during a week of unbearable heat. The room they put us in had a broken A/C, no toilet paper, mold in the shower, and a toilet that had not been flushed in a while. Called the front desk to complain, especially upon discovering that the toilet could not flush. The staff laughed and said they weren't sure how to fix it. After an hour and several more calls, they moved us to a "deluxe suite," or something. It was bigger and had working A/C, but I've certainly would have liked a clean bathroom. This place is utterly disgusting with useless staff. I recommend staying away. Oh, and the promised "wireless internet" was neither wireless, nor a connection to the internet. Nothing worked.
